Companies ranked by earnings

Companies: 10,639 total earnings (TTM): C$10.796 T suggest/edit icon suggest/edit icon download icondownload icon
Rank by Market Cap Earnings Revenue Employees P/E ratio Dividend % Market Cap gain Market Cap loss Operating Margin Cost to borrow Total assets Net assets Total liabilities Total debt Cash on hand Price to Book More +
RankName
EarningsPriceTodayPrice (30 days)Country
favorite icon1001
C$2.13 B C$61.510.00%๐Ÿ‡ฎ๐Ÿ‡ช Ireland
favorite icon1002
C$2.12 B C$17.780.85%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1003
C$2.12 B C$178.820.08%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1004
C$2.12 B C$5.601.09%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1005
C$2.12 B C$1.540.11%๐Ÿ‡ญ๐Ÿ‡ฐ Hong Kong
favorite icon1006
C$2.12 B C$15.002.77%๐Ÿ‡น๐Ÿ‡ท Turkey
favorite icon1007
C$2.12 B C$219.730.55%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1008
C$2.11 B C$93.420.51%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on1009
C$2.11 B C$183.420.40%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1010
C$2.10 B C$435.220.07%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1011
C$2.10 B C$24.440.85%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1012
C$2.10 B C$37.050.88%๐Ÿ‡ฉ๐Ÿ‡ฐ Denmark
favorite icon1013
C$2.09 B C$63.532.33%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1014
C$2.09 B C$3.650.21%๐Ÿ‡ง๐Ÿ‡ท Brazil
favorite icon1015
C$2.09 B C$30.530.27%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1016
C$2.08 B C$1,6460.74%๐Ÿ‡จ๐Ÿ‡ญ Switzerland
favorite icon1017
C$2.08 B C$13.732.81%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1018
C$2.08 B C$2.811.49%๐Ÿ‡ง๐Ÿ‡ท Brazil
favorite icon1019
C$2.08 B C$6.311.18%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1020
C$2.08 B C$128.400.89%๐Ÿ‡ต๐Ÿ‡ฑ Poland
favorite icon1021
C$2.07 B C$10.840.25%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1022
C$2.07 B C$3.290.27%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1023
C$2.06 B C$5.170.42%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1024
C$2.06 B C$0.821.77%๐Ÿ‡ญ๐Ÿ‡ฐ Hong Kong
favorite icon1025
C$2.05 B C$101.620.59%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1026
C$2.05 B C$123.260.80%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1027
C$2.05 B C$12.890.10%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1028
C$2.05 B C$53.100.12%๐Ÿ‡ซ๐Ÿ‡ท France
favorite icon1029
C$2.05 B C$6.181.57%๐Ÿ‡ธ๐Ÿ‡ฆ S. Arabia
favorite icon1030
C$2.05 B C$28.721.51%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1031
C$2.04 B C$65.961.12%๐Ÿ‡จ๐Ÿ‡ฆ Canada
favorite icon1032
C$2.04 B C$236.790.60%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1033
C$2.04 B C$12.090.73%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1034
C$2.03 B C$25.860.68%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1035
C$2.03 B C$0.563.04%๐Ÿ‡ฎ๐Ÿ‡ฉ Indonesia
favorite icon1036
C$2.03 B C$2.150.26%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1037
C$2.03 B C$96.281.09%๐Ÿ‡ซ๐Ÿ‡ฎ Finland
favorite icon1038
C$2.03 B C$350.836.61%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1039
C$2.03 B C$3.440.26%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1040
C$2.02 B C$10.713.34%๐Ÿ‡จ๐Ÿ‡ฑ Chile
favorite icon1041
C$2.02 B C$63.070.10%๐Ÿ‡จ๐Ÿ‡ฆ Canada
favorite icon1042
C$2.01 B C$623.675.09%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1043
C$2.01 B C$14.152.80%๐Ÿ‡ณ๐Ÿ‡ด Norway
favorite icon1044
C$2.01 B C$159.252.90%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1045
C$2.01 B C$25.911.22%๐Ÿ‡จ๐Ÿ‡ฆ Canada
favorite icon1046
C$2.01 B C$29.060.77%๐Ÿ‡ซ๐Ÿ‡ฎ Finland
favorite icon1047
C$2.01 B C$16.110.37%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on1048
C$2.00 B C$12.602.00%๐Ÿ‡ง๐Ÿ‡ท Brazil
favorite icon1049
C$2.00 B C$52.870.00%๐Ÿ‡ต๐Ÿ‡ญ Philippines
favorite icon1050
C$2.00 B C$26.811.04%๐Ÿ‡ธ๐Ÿ‡ช Sweden
favorite icon1051
C$2.00 B C$5,3120.69%๐Ÿ‡จ๐Ÿ‡ญ Switzerland
favorite icon1052
C$2.00 B C$39.002.07%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1053
C$2.00 B C$0.331.75%๐Ÿ‡ฑ๐Ÿ‡บ Luxembourg
favorite icon1054
C$1.99 B C$73.890.86%๐Ÿ‡ฎ๐Ÿ‡ณ India
favorite icon1055
C$1.99 B C$211.533.27%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1056
C$1.99 B C$2.240.80%๐Ÿ‡น๐Ÿ‡ท Turkey
favorite icon1057
C$1.99 B C$47.361.88%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1058
C$1.99 B C$274.171.07%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1059
C$1.99 B C$348.380.76%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1060
C$1.98 B C$108.500.05%๐Ÿ‡จ๐Ÿ‡ญ Switzerland
favorite icon1061
C$1.98 B C$2.100.76%๐Ÿ‡ญ๐Ÿ‡ฐ Hong Kong
favorite icon1062
C$1.98 B C$20.430.00%๐Ÿ‡ฒ๐Ÿ‡พ Malaysia
favorite icon1063
C$1.98 B C$72.510.63%๐Ÿ‡ฉ๐Ÿ‡ช Germany
favorite icon1064
C$1.98 B C$20.682.84%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1065
C$1.98 B C$12.762.62%๐Ÿ‡ง๐Ÿ‡ท Brazil
favorite icon1066
C$1.98 B C$66.661.06%๐Ÿ‡ฆ๐Ÿ‡ท Argentina
favorite icon1067
C$1.97 B C$170.180.16%๐Ÿ‡ฐ๐Ÿ‡ท S. Korea
favorite icon1068
C$1.97 B C$4.461.22%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1069
C$1.97 B C$258.290.89%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1070
C$1.97 B C$143.690.25%๐Ÿ‡ณ๐Ÿ‡ฑ Netherlands
favorite icon1071
C$1.97 B C$119.760.10%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1072
C$1.97 B C$96.304.94%๐Ÿ‡ญ๐Ÿ‡ฐ Hong Kong
favorite icon1073
C$1.96 B C$28.710.10%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1074
C$1.96 B C$1.020.38%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1075
C$1.96 B C$65.932.27%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1076
C$1.96 B C$231.830.77%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1077
C$1.96 B C$222.059.73%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1078
C$1.96 B C$21.703.90%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1079
C$1.96 B C$14.971.37%๐Ÿ‡ฌ๐Ÿ‡ง UK
favorite icon1080
C$1.95 B C$6.120.22%๐Ÿ‡ฒ๐Ÿ‡พ Malaysia
favorite icon1081
C$1.95 B C$71.560.31%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1082
C$1.95 B C$9.010.82%๐Ÿ‡ฆ๐Ÿ‡บ Australia
favorite icon1083
C$1.95 B C$23.650.58%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1084
C$1.94 B C$389.061.43%๐Ÿ‡ง๐Ÿ‡ช Belgium
favorite icon1085
C$1.94 B C$155.301.35%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1086
C$1.94 B C$409.821.09%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1087
C$1.94 B C$0.130.09%๐Ÿ‡จ๐Ÿ‡ฑ Chile
favorite icon1088
C$1.93 B C$89.991.80%๐Ÿ‡ฐ๐Ÿ‡ท S. Korea
favorite icon1089
C$1.93 B C$1.061.81%๐Ÿ‡จ๐Ÿ‡ณ China
favorite icon1090
C$1.92 B C$12.340.07% Hungary
favorite icon1091
C$1.92 B C$250.980.56%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1092
C$1.91 B C$64.120.41%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1093
C$1.91 B C$192.332.23%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1094
C$1.91 B C$32.872.73%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1095
C$1.91 B C$48.840.67%๐Ÿ‡ฏ๐Ÿ‡ต Japan
favorite icon1096
C$1.91 B C$178.720.73%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1097
C$1.91 B C$219.600.36%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1098
C$1.91 B C$1.671.33%๐Ÿ‡น๐Ÿ‡ผ Taiwan
favorite icon1099
C$1.90 B C$603.236.17%๐Ÿ‡บ๐Ÿ‡ธ USA
favorite icon1100
C$1.90 B C$483.060.19%๐Ÿ‡บ๐Ÿ‡ธ USA

This is the list of the world's most profitable public companies by earnings (TTM).